Why Employee Retention Is a Business Imperative
High employee turnover doesn’t just disrupt teams, it impacts productivity, increases recruitment and training costs, and weakens business performance. Retaining skilled employees is about creating an environment where people feel valued and have the resources to thrive.
One of the most effective ways to build that environment is through well-designed employee benefit plans. These programs directly influence how employees perceive their workplace and whether they see a future with their current employer.
The Connection Between Employee Benefits and Retention
Today’s employees expect more than basic compensation. They’re looking for organizations that take a genuine interest in their well-being, financially, physically, and emotionally. A comprehensive employee benefits program sends a clear and powerful message: We’re invested in your success, today and for the future.
Here’s how the right employee benefits contribute directly to stronger retention:
- Financial Well-Being: Offering retirement savings plans, financial education resources, and tax-advantaged savings options helps employees feel more secure about their financial future.
- Health and Wellness Support: Access to health insurance, mental health resources, and wellness programs demonstrates a commitment to long-term employee well-being.
- Work-Life Balance: Flexible work arrangements, paid time off, and family support benefits reduce burnout and increase job satisfaction.
- Career Growth and Stability: When employees know they’re supported through every life stage, they’re more likely to stay and grow within the organization.
How to Build Employee Benefit Plans That Encourage Loyalty
Providing employee benefits is important, but offering the right mix of benefits is what really drives loyalty. The most successful organizations design their employee benefit programs around the specific needs and priorities of their workforce.
Key strategies for building loyalty through benefits include:
- Understand Employee Needs: Conduct regular surveys or focus groups to understand what your employees value most in a benefits program.
- Prioritize Flexibility: Offer a range of options so employees can choose the benefits that best match their personal circumstances.
- Communicate Clearly and Consistently: Employees can’t value what they don’t understand. Ensure benefits are easy to access and well-communicated throughout the year, not just during enrollment periods.
- Regularly Review and Evolve Your Plan: As your workforce changes, so should your benefits. Regularly assess your programs to ensure they remain relevant and competitive.
